Itinerary

Expand All

Day 1 : Arrive In Tirana

Location: Tirana

Accommodation Name: Hotel Millenium

Meals Included: Breakfast

After arriving in Tirana, enjoy an afternoon at leisure in Pogradec on the shores of Lake Ohrid. The old town, known for its Ottoman and Balkan architecture, is a treasure trove of historical charm. Notable landmarks include the 2400-year-old castle, the royal tombs of Selca, and the settlements of Lini.

Day 2 : Pogradec To Korce

Location: Korce

Accommodation Name: Hotel

Meals Included: Breakfast

Cycle along the shores of Lake Ohrid into the countryside surrounding Pogradec. Following the road that connects the lake with the city of Korce, you'll pass a collage of fields where local farmers attend to their crops. Often referred to as the little Paris of Albania, Korce has a rich history of artistic traditions showcased by its array of museums. The Old Baazar is a highlight with its well-preserved architecture, characterised by low-lying houses and picturesque cobblestone streets.

Day 3 : Korce To Shelegur

Location: Korce

Accommodation Name: Hotel

Meals Included: Breakfast

Leaving behind the city of Korce, you cycle along quiet roads through remote countryside hugging the Gramoz Mountain range which borders Albania and Greece, passing traditional Albanian villages where time seems to have stood still.

Day 4 : Shelegur To Permet

Location: Permet

Accommodation Name: Hotel

Meals Included: Breakfast

Cycling through pine forest, you descend to the Vjose River, which runs untamed from source to sea. Cycling along its banks, you will experience the serene and unspoiled beauty of one of Europe's last free-flowing rivers. Along the Vjosa River, the countryside is dotted with small farms and expansive vineyards. Now close to the southern tip of Albania, the mountains, and villages in Greece ever-present on the horizon. On arrival in Petran, you have the option to explore the nearby thermal springs of Benje renowned for their therapeutic properties. Continue to the city of Permet, where you'll be captivated by the delightful aromas of local fruit and can sample the unique and excellent flavours of the region's wine and raki.

Day 5 : Permet To Gjirokaster

Location: Gjirokaster

Accommodation Name: Hotel

Today is an easier ride, leaving Permet you continue along the bright blue waters of the Vjose River. Cutting through the Trebeshina and Nemercka mountain ranges via the picturesque Kelcyra Gorge you reach Gjirokaster. After 38 km of cycling you will get a private transfer (approx 25 mins) to miss the busy road and arrive earlier to Gjirokaster. Known as the 'Stone City' due to its distinctive Ottoman-era architecture, Gjirokaster is a UNESCO World Heritage site that captivates visitors with its historical significance. Home to the second largest fortifications in the Balkans, Gjirokastra Castle rises on the hilltop overlooking the city offering panoramic views of the Drino River valley. Wander the cobblestone streets and visit the old Bazar, a vibrant place to experience local culture.

Day 6 : Gjirokaster To Sarande

Location: Sarande

Accommodation Name: Hotel

Meals Included: Breakfast

A short transfer will bring you to the Muzina Pass. From here you cycle through countryside to reach Butrint National Park, where you have the opportunity to visit the best archaeological site in Albania. Crossing the Vivari Channel on a short ferry ride you reach the UNESCO site of Butrint. Over the centuries, Butrint has served as a Greek colony, a Roman city, and a bishopric. Walk through the ruins of theatres, temples, and basilicas, and marvel at the blend of Greek, Roman, Byzantine, and Venetian influences that have shaped this region. As you continue your ride, enjoy views of Lake Butrint, the Ionian Sea, and Corfu. Arrive in the coastal city of Sarande on the Albanian Riviera.

Day 7 : Sarande To Himare

Location: Himare

Accommodation Name: Hotel

Meals Included: Breakfast

Leaving the city of Sarande, today begins with steady climb northwards following Albania's beautiful coastal road along the glistening Ionian Sea. Descending to the long beach and bay of Potam before arriving at the fishing town of Himare. Spend the afternoon relaxing on the pebbled beach where both locals and tourists come to enjoy the beautiful turquoise water.

Day 8 : Depart Himare

Location: Himare

Meals Included: Breakfast

After breakfast, leave Himare and the beautiful Albanian Riviera.
